In Caraș-Severin County, Romania, Vrani is a provincial capital. It is home to 1,215 people.
Vrani can be found at 45.04° N, 21.49° E in the Northern Hemisphere. It is part of the Caraș-Severin County division in Romania.
With a population of 1,215, Vrani ranks #3,720 among the 18,248 cities and localities registered in Romania.
